Raymond Usseglio, Chateauneuf Du Pape Part Anges Brut Zero This is at once veryDominated by Mourvdre (70%) and new oak (80%), the 2016 Chateauneuf du Pape la Part des Anges is a beauty, as long as you set aside preconceptions about typicity and what you think Chteauneuf should taste like. Toasted cedar and vanilla accent black cherry and cola notes in this full bodied, rich, plush wine that comes at you in supple waves of generosity and flavor. It's approachable (although primary) right now, but it should really hit its stride
